The High Court on Wednesday extended the bail of the Bangladesh Nationalist Party (BNP) chairperson Khaleda Zia in the Zia Orphanage Trust graft case until 13 August.

An HC bench comprising justice M Enayetur Rahim and justice Md Mostafizur Rahman passed the order following a petition filed by Khaleda’s lawyers, reports UNB.

The HC also adjourned the hearing of the case until Thursday.

On 31 July, the High Court extended the bail of the chief of country’s principal opposition party, BNP, until 8 August in the graft case while on 25 July the court extended her bail until 31 July in the case.

On 5 July, a petition was filed with the High Court seeking an extension of its earlier order granting a four-month interim bail to Khaleda Zia in the graft case.

On February 8, Dhaka Special Court-5 convicted the former prime minister and BNP chairperson Khaleda Zia and sentenced her to five years’ imprisonment in the Zia Orphanage Trust graft case.

She was then sent to the abandoned central jail at Nazimuddin Road in the capital.
